The code block has 2 directives:
phmdoctest-label test_datetime
phmdoctest-mark.slow
The first directive names the generated test function.
The second directive add @pytest.mark.slow decorator. slow is a pytest user defined marker that is used to select/deselect test cases using the pytest –marker command line option.
from datetime import date
d = date.fromordinal(730920) # 730920th day after 1. 1. 0001
print(d)
2002-03-11
